#ifndef AUTH_COMMON_AUTH_H
#define AUTH_COMMON_AUTH_H

#include "librpc/gen_ndr/auth.h"

#define USER_INFO_CASE_INSENSITIVE_USERNAME 0x01 /* username may be in any case */
#define USER_INFO_CASE_INSENSITIVE_PASSWORD 0x02 /* password may be in any case */
#define USER_INFO_DONT_CHECK_UNIX_ACCOUNT   0x04 /* don't check unix account status */
#define USER_INFO_INTERACTIVE_LOGON         0x08 /* Interactive logon */
/*unused #define USER_INFO_LOCAL_SAM_ONLY   0x10    Only authenticate against the local SAM, do not map missing passwords to NO_SUCH_USER */
#define USER_INFO_INFO3_AND_NO_AUTHZ        0x20 /* Only fill in server_info->info3 and do not do any authorization steps */

enum auth_password_state {
	AUTH_PASSWORD_PLAIN = 1,
	AUTH_PASSWORD_HASH = 2,
	AUTH_PASSWORD_RESPONSE = 3
};

#define AUTH_SESSION_INFO_DEFAULT_GROUPS     0x01 /* Add the user to the default world and network groups */
#define AUTH_SESSION_INFO_AUTHENTICATED      0x02 /* Add the user to the 'authenticated users' group */
#define AUTH_SESSION_INFO_SIMPLE_PRIVILEGES  0x04 /* Use a trivial map between users and privileges, rather than a DB */
#define AUTH_SESSION_INFO_UNIX_TOKEN         0x08 /* The returned token must have the unix_token and unix_info elements provided */
#define AUTH_SESSION_INFO_NTLM               0x10 /* The returned token must have authenticated-with-NTLM flag set */
#define AUTH_SESSION_INFO_FORCE_COMPOUNDED_AUTHENTICATION  0x20 /* The user authenticated with a device. */
#define AUTH_SESSION_INFO_DEVICE_DEFAULT_GROUPS     0x40 /* Add the device to the default world and network groups */
#define AUTH_SESSION_INFO_DEVICE_AUTHENTICATED      0x80 /* Add the device to the 'authenticated users' group */

/*
 * Log details of an authentication attempt.
 * Successful and unsuccessful attempts are logged.
 *
 * NOTE: msg_ctx and lp_ctx is optional, but when supplied allows streaming the
 * authentication events over the message bus.
 */
struct authn_audit_info;
void log_authentication_event(struct imessaging_context *msg_ctx,
			      struct loadparm_context *lp_ctx,
			      const struct timeval *start_time,
			      const struct auth_usersupplied_info *ui,
			      NTSTATUS status,
			      const char *domain_name,
			      const char *account_name,
			      struct dom_sid *sid,
			      const struct authn_audit_info *client_audit_info,
			      const struct authn_audit_info *server_audit_info);

/*
 * Log details of a successful authorization to a service.
 *
 * Only successful authorizations are logged.  For clarity:
 * - NTLM bad passwords will be recorded by log_authentication_event
 * - Kerberos decrypt failures need to be logged in gensec_gssapi et al
 *
 * The service may later refuse authorization due to an ACL.
 *
 *
 * NOTE: msg_ctx and lp_ctx is optional, but when supplied allows streaming the
 * authorization events over the message bus.
 */
